Top 5 Physics Puzzle Games on iOS in Chile: Q1 2022
Analyzing the performance of the top 5 physics puzzle games on iOS in Chile for Q1 2022, highlighting tr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
In Q1 2022, the top 5 physics puzzle games on iOS in Chile demonstrated var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Data from Sensor Tower provides a detailed look at these trends.
Pull the Pin from Popcore GmbH saw a noticeable decline in both downloads and active users throughout the quarter. Weekly downloads peaked at around 2.2K at the start of the quarter before dropping to 314 by the end of March. Active users followed a similar trend, starting at approximately 5.8K and decreasing to 1.2K. Revenue experienced fluctuations, peaking at $33 in the week of March 7.
Bazooka Boy by SUPERSONIC STUDIOS LTD maintained a relatively stable performance in terms of downloads and active users. Weekly downloads hovered around the 900 to 1K range, with a slight dip to 693 in early March. Active users remained consistent, fluctuating between 2.1K and 2.5K throughout the quarter.
Angry Birds 2 from Rovio Entertainment Oyj showed strong performance in weekly revenue and active users. Revenue peaked at $620 at the beginning of the quarter and remained above $200 throughout. Downloads were steady, averaging around 900 to 1K per week. Active users also remained robust, starting at 16.1K and ending the quarter at 15.4K.
Rope Savior 3D by Lion Studios experienced a decline in downloads and active users mid-quarter but showed signs of recovery towards the end. Downloads dropped from 2.2K initially to 25 in mid-February, before rebounding to 321 by March 21. Active users followed a similar pattern, peaking at 2.9K in early January and ending at 1.4K.
Cut the Rope from ZeptoLab UK Limited demonstrated consistent performance in revenue and active users. Weekly revenue saw fluctuations, peaking at $115 in late February. Downloads were steady, ranging from 300 to 950 per week. Active users showed stability, maintaining between 800 to 1.4K throughout the quarter.
